Mexican ferrous scrap prices continue to drop; further price cuts expected

October 13, 2021 / www.metalbulletin.com / Article Link

Prices for almost all steel scrap grades continued to drop in Mexico in the week ended Friday October 8, with market participants indicating there was no end in sight for the price reductions.

Some buyers have been applying gradual price adjustments on a weekly basis, while others made sharp decreases at the beginning of the month.More price reductions are being planned, with at least one major scrap buyer announcing cuts of 300 pesos ($15) for all grades in the first two days of the week to Friday October 15 and another reduction of the same amount expected later in...
